Using WhatsApp Web on iPad:

WhatsApp is one of the most popular messaging apps in the world, with over 2 billion monthly active users. The app is available on a range of mobile devices, including Android and iOS smartphones, but there is no official WhatsApp app for iPad. However, there is a way to use WhatsApp on your iPad or iPod touch by using WhatsApp.web. Here’s how:

  • To use WhatsApp Web on your iPad, simply go to web.whatsapp.com in Safari. The caution here is that till iOS 12, the iPad doesn’t directly support the WhatsApp Web. If you are using iPadOS 13 or later, then you are good to go- this will automatically load the desktop version of WhatsApp Web for iPads.
  • For anyone on iOS 12 or earlier, you will be redirected to the WhatsApp home page. However, don’t worry. All you need to open the WhatsApp web is desktop mode and refresh the site.
  • You will now be asked to scan a QR code using your WhatsApp smartphone app in order to link your device to your account. Open WhatsApp on your smartphone and go to Settings > WhatsApp Web/Desktop. 
  • Point your camera at the QR code displayed on your screen and wait for it to be scanned automatically. 
  • You should now see all of your WhatsApp conversations appear on your screen. Tap on any conversation to start chatting.

Is Whatsapp for iPad Coming Soon?

For a long time, people have been eagerly anticipating an iPad version of Whatsapp. In August 2021, it was reported that a Whatsapp app for iPad is in the works, with plans to bring the messaging software to iPads (and Android tablets). According to recent reports, WhatsApp for iPad will be released with multi-device support. In May 2021, WABetaInfo tweeted that: “Multi-device 2.0 will let people link an additional mobile phone or tablet (WhatsApp for iPad/Android tablet) to the same WhatsApp account in the future.”

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: Can I use WhatsApp on my iPad?

A: No, there is no official WhatsApp app for the iPad. However, you can use WhatsApp Web to access your messages on an iPad.

Q: Will there be a WhatsApp app for the iPad?

A: There is no official word from WhatsApp about whether or not an app for the iPad is in development. However, recent reports suggest that such an app may be released in the future with multi-device support.

Q: Can I make calls using WhatsApp on my iPad?

A: No, you cannot make calls using WhatsApp on your iPad or iPod touch. However, you can send text messages and share photos, videos, and your location with your contacts.

Q: Can I record voice messages using WhatsApp on my iPad?

A: Yes, you can record voice messages using WhatsApp Web on your iPad or iPod touch. Simply tap and hold the mic button in a conversation to start recording. Release the button to send your message.
